CO2 Emissions from Solid Fuel Consumption in European Union

Source: World Bank
Last Updated: July 1, 2023

Co2 emissions from solid fuel consumption reached 1,188,522 kt in 2016 in the European Union, according to World Bank / EIA. This is 3.91% less than in the previous year.

Historically, CO2 emissions from solid fuel consumption in the European Union reached an all time high of 1,416,646 kt in 1991 and an all time low of 918,739 kt in 2014.
